Getting Started

AJAIA (ADO Jira AI Assistant) is an AI-powered productivity tool that helps development teams work smarter with Azure DevOps and Jira. It uses Claude AI to automatically break down epics into user stories, features, and tasks, syncs work items between platforms, and provides intelligent insights to accelerate your workflow.

AJAIA is not sold separately. There is no public signup. Accounts are provisioned for clients as part of an engagement with Jefrie, with one onboarding walkthrough included. Work with Jefrie to start.

Access follows your engagement. A Build Sprint includes access for the duration of the build plus 90 days after handoff. An Orchestration Retainer includes full access for as long as the retainer is active, with seats and onboarding included.

Access winds down over a 30-day sunset. A data export is available during offboarding. The platform is supported during active engagements and provided as-is otherwise.

Features & Usage

AJAIA uses Claude AI to analyze your epic description and automatically generate a complete work breakdown structure. It creates user stories, features, tasks, and even test cases with Gherkin scenarios. You can review, edit, and customize the generated items before pushing them to Azure DevOps or Jira.

Yes! AJAIA is designed to work with both platforms. You can connect to Azure DevOps, Jira, or both simultaneously. This is especially useful for teams that need to sync work items between the two platforms or are migrating from one to the other.

MCP (Model Context Protocol) integration allows you to connect AJAIA directly to AI coding assistants like Claude Desktop, VS Code with Copilot, and Cursor. This enables your AI assistant to access your work items, create tasks, and update project status directly from your IDE without context switching.

The Azure DevOps Extension brings AJAIA's epic breakdown directly into your Azure DevOps interface. From any work item you can generate a breakdown without leaving Azure DevOps. It is provided to active clients as part of an engagement.

Troubleshooting

Make sure you've entered the correct organization URL and Personal Access Token (PAT). Your PAT needs the following scopes: Work Items (Read & Write), Project (Read). Check that your PAT hasn't expired. See our Azure DevOps integration guide for detailed setup instructions.

Complex epics with detailed descriptions may take 30-60 seconds to process. If the breakdown is taking longer than 2 minutes, try refreshing the page and starting again. Large epics may need to be broken down in stages for best results.

Try these steps: 1) Make sure you have the latest version installed from our download page. 2) On Windows, right-click and "Run as Administrator" for the first launch. 3) Check that your firewall isn't blocking the app. 4) Try reinstalling the application.
